| Intel Installation Intel InstallationTo install the Gelid Tranquillo the first thing you have to do is select the proper backplate for you Intel system. This is required as Gelid has not gone for an all in one approach to the backplate but rather uses three separate and yet distinct back plates: one designed for 775 (smallest), one for 1156 (mid sized) and the largest being the 1366 backplate. After you line up the holes of the backplate through your motherboards, you then have to install the Intel retaining brackets. Unlike the multiple backplate issue, Gelid has gone with a simple all in one Intel retaining bracket which is used on 777, 1155 and 1366. These brackets are a two part affair. To put this another way: you have to install two brackets irregardless of what Intel system you use, and install one bracket to each side of the base. Unlike most other CPU cooling solutions which have used a two part retaining bracket scheme, the Gelid’s brackets are held in position by a combination of one screw and a lip and grove like clamping mechanism. The upper edge of these brackets has a slightly extended edge which when properly positioned fits snugly and securely into a grove in the aluminum edge of the top of the base of the Tranquillo. When the cooler is properly positioned you then simply grab one of the four bolts and gently thread it into the backplate. We found it easiest if you give each of the four bolts one turn to get them started and then go onto another bolt in a diagonal pattern. With the Gelid Tranquillo CPU firmly and properly mounted the last thing you have to do is install the fan. This cooler uses the tried and true wire tension and retention system that is found on most cooler out there and we have no issue with this whatsoever.. At this point we would like to take a moment and go over the compatibility issues we ran into with this moderate sized cooler and our Gigabyte 1366 motherboard. To be honest, since the fin array starts quite high, you shouldn’t run into many issues with motherboard compatibility unless your board has abnormally tall heatsinks. The other crucial detail they got right was in not making this cooler so deep that the fan would overhang the ram. Even if your are running exotically cooled ram, there will be no problems as long as the sticks (or there heat-spreaders) are unusually wide. | ||
